In this She Adventures NZ podcast episode, host Senka Radonich is joined by Harriet Watson, who spent 8 days (and 650kms!) biking and running her way along the rugged West Coast to bring awareness to Endometriosis and raise funds for the Endometriosis NZ Helpline.

With the support of her family & sponsor ANZCO Foods, she could never have dreamed of, or done this epic challenge.

At the age of 22, she has now raised over $15,000 for the Endometriosis New Zealand helpline with the different challenges she has done.
IN THIS EPISODE WE TALK ABOUT
Harriet's journey to discovering she had endometriosis.What motivated her to do her first challenge of Kayaking 100kms on the Avon River in Christchurch NZ.What strategies she uses she’s when she’s in pain, but has to keep going.What it really took mentally and physically to get through the eight day, 650kms West Coast challenge.The insights and discoveries she had along the way about who she is and what she is capable of.And so much more…

I’ve found it impossible to ignore my obsession with inspiring women to get outdoors.
I launched Adventure Girls in my mid 20’s and over 15 years took 1,000’s of women on adventures across NZ. Then at 40 I said ‘hell yes’ to a new adventure, sold ⅔ of everything I owned, built out the back of my 4WD ‘Hank the Tank’, left Auckland and traveled NZ for 5 months exploring.
Now I live in the South Island of NZ, have added Stan the Van, a Ford Transit Van I’ve semi converted into the mix, and Adventure Girls evolved into the She Adventures Podcast.
